File indexing completed on 2024-12-22 04:52:51

0001 /*
0002     SPDX-FileCopyrightText: 2009 Igor Trindade Oliveira <igor_trindade@yahoo.com.br>
0003     based on kdepimlibs/akonadi/tests/benchmarker.cpp wrote by Robert Zwerus <arzie@dds.nl>
0004 
0005     SPDX-License-Identifier: LGPL-2.0-or-later
0006 */
0007 
0008 #include "maildirimport.h"
0009 #include <QDebug>
0010 #include <QTest>
0011 
0012 #define WAIT_TIME 100
0013 
0014 MailDirImport::MailDirImport(const QString &dir)
0015     : MailDir(dir)
0016 {
0017 }
0018 
0019 void MailDirImport::runTest()
0020 {
0021     done = false;
0022     timer.start();
0023     qDebug() << "  Synchronising resource.";
0024     currentInstance.synchronize();
0025     while (!done) {
0026         QTest::qWait(WAIT_TIME);
0027     }
0028     outputStats(QStringLiteral("import"));
0029 }
0030 
0031 #include "moc_maildirimport.cpp"